#2812d0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2812d0 is composed of 15.7% red, 7.1% green and 81.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80.8% cyan, 91.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 246.9 degrees, a saturation of 84.1% and a lightness of 44.3%. #2812d0 color hex could be obtained by blending #5024ff with #0000a1. Closest websafe color is: #3300cc.

Shades and Tints of #2812d0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020109 is the darkest color, while #f7f6f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#2812d0
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6b6979 is the less saturated color, while #1b01e1 is the most saturated one.
